Output 5eef8d6e66ae0b06eb09b4e999493731bf99cd0c3ff241352ddc7e17feb842e2:1

value
31674524247
script pubkey
OP_0 OP_PUSHBYTES_20 1f512670295b778e8f74cbae923990b72ce17c59
address
bc1qragjvupftdmcarm5ewhfywvskukwzlzesxyt9n
transaction
5eef8d6e66ae0b06eb09b4e999493731bf99cd0c3ff241352ddc7e17feb842e2
confirmations
200525
spent
true